A floppy disk, often referred to as a floppy, is a type of data storage device that was widely used during the late 20th century. It consists of a thin and flexible magnetic storage medium encased in a square or rectangular plastic shell. Originally developed in the 1970s, floppy disks were available in various sizes, with the 3.5-inch version being the most popular due to its compact design and increased storage capacity. Despite their limited capacity compared to modern storage solutions, floppy disks played a crucial role in the early days of personal computing, facilitating the distribution and storage of software and data.
Definition of DVDA DVD, short for Digital Versatile Disc, is an optical disc storage format that emerged in the mid-1990s. It quickly gained popularity as a medium for storing and distributing digital data, including video, audio, and software. DVDs are capable of holding significantly more data than their predecessor, the CD, thanks to their higher density of data storage. Unlike CDs, DVDs can be dual-layered, allowing for even greater storage capacity. DVDs are widely used for movies, video games, and software applications, and they provide a reliable and portable means of data storage, offering high-quality playback for digital media.
